U+9296 "" CJK Unified Ideograph-# is a Chinese character that primarily represents a unit of weight and currency in East Asian history, specifically the ancient Chinese measure known as a "zhu," which equals approximately 0.65 grams and was used as a fractional unit of the silver tael. This ideograph combines the radical for "metal" or "gold" on the left with the phonetic component "朱" on the right, reflecting its association with precious metal coinage. It is historically significant for its role in the currency systems of imperial China, where coins were often denominated in zhu, such as the Wu Zhu coinage that circulated for centuries. The character also appears in Japanese and Korean contexts, where it denotes the same weight unit and is used in certain traditional measurements and historical texts.
